I Still Cannot Believe This Story 

  • comment(64)

By Neal Boortz

It’s the Alameda, California story.  I’m sure you’ve heard about it.  A somewhat deranged 53-year-old man commits suicide by walking into the San Francisco Bay while Alameda firemen and policemen stand on the beach and do absolutely nothing.  Well, that’s not quite fair .. they did do something.  While the man was out there drowning they talked to his mother and asked for her name, his name, and other information.  Why didn’t they go into the water and save this guy?  Policy.   The city employees did not have the training to do a water rescue … so policy said they were not permitted to go into the water to save this guy.  Alameda is an island, by the way --- and their first responders weren’t allowed to do water rescues. 

This is government.  This is how governments operate.  This is how governments wield their power.  The more power and influence we allow governments to have over our lives, the more we will encounter incidents like the Alameda suicide.
